Server Fax

When using the Server Fax, a document is scanned and sent to a fax server on the network. The fax
server then sends the fax over a telephone line to a fax machine.
Notes:
The Server Fax service must be enabled before use, and a fax server must be configured.
Server Fax cannot be used together with the Fax feature. When Server Fax is in use, the
touch screen Fax button activates Server Fax.
Server Fax cannot be used together with the Internet Fax feature. When Server Fax is in
use, the touch screen Internet Fax button does not appear.

Sending a Server Fax

1.
Load the original on the document glass or in the document feeder.
On the control panel, touch Services Home.
2.
3.
Touch Fax.
Enter the number using the alphanumeric keypad, then touch Add.
4.
5.
Touch New Recipients, enter the number using the touch screen keyboard, touch Add, then
touch Close.
6.
To use a number previously stored in the Address Book:
a.
Touch Address Book.
b.
Touch the arrows to scroll through the list.
c.
Touch the desired address.
d.
Touch Add, then touch Close.
7.
Adjust fax options if necessary. For details, see
8.
Press the green Start button. The printer scans the pages and transmits the fax document when
all pages have been scanned.
